Client View
The client view is infinitely less complicated than the Admin view. In fact, the client does not see the admin interface at all.
First, clients will login to the editor by browsing to http://mywebsitedomain/admin if their site is live or http://mywebsitedomain.yourwebisonline.com/admin if their site is still in development.

Once logged in, your client will see a small gear icon floating over their website at the upper right of the browser window. When your client is at an area of the site they would like to edit, they simply click the gear icon and a small control bar will display across the top of the website. They toggle the edit button located in the menu bar to “ON”. The site will darken with an overlay except for the editable sections that you defined within the admin and have added to your design. The client can then click on the section they wish to edit and that’s it! The form with the various fields you defined in the admin will appear in a modal window for your client to edit. Once finished, the client clicks the save button and the site is instantly updated.

Note: There is no Webpop branding or reference of any kind in the Client Editor. Your client will simply navigate the site as normal. Check out the “on-site editing” screencast to see this feature in action.
